Accessory Drive - 2.7L Diesel
Principles of Operation
The 2.7L diesel engine uses two accessory drive systems, the front end accessory drive (FEAD), and
the fuel injection pump drive.
FEAD
The FEAD drives: the coolant pump, the generator, the power assisted steering pump, and the air
conditioning compressor, driven from the crankshaft pulley via a single six-ribbed belt.
Fuel injection pump drive
The fuel injection pump is driven from the exhaust camshaft of the left-hand cylinder bank, by a
single, toothed belt.
The fuel injection pump is NOT timed to the engine.

Noise definitions
Description of
noise
Definition/Possible cause
Squeal
Continuous shriek, most noticeable when the engine is accelerated (usually
associated with lack of belt tension, contamination or wet slip)

Chirp
Twittering noise that usually stops at engine speeds above idle. Usually associated
with misaligned pulleys
Whine
Continuous noise, changing frequency with engine speed, generally associated with
rotating components (generator, idler, etc)
Rattle
Metallic knocking, often a loose component or tensioner fault
Rumble
Bearing noise

Pinpoint tests
PINPOINT TEST G552803p1 :
ELIMINATE THE FEAD AS THE
SOURCE OF NOISE
G552803t1 : CHECK FOR THE PRESENCE OF NOISE WITH THE FEAD BELT
DISCONNECTED
1. Remove the ignition key. 2. Disconnect the FEAD belt,
Accessory Drive Belt - 2.7L Diesel (12.10.40) 3. Start the engine and allow to idle. 4. Check for the
presence of the noise.
Is the noise still apparent?
-> Yes
The FEAD is not the cause of the noise. Confirm the symptoms, check for alternative causes.
-> No
Inspect the FEAD belt and driven components. Check the driven components for excessive resistance
to rotation.
